NEW YORK: Cuomo signs the Ex-Lax fish bill

September 12, 2016 — Seriously, you read that headline correctly.

Among the bills signed by Gov. Andrew Cuomo on Friday is legislation that would ban the sale of escolar — a fish that causes some cases, uhhh, distressing gastrointestinal effects for diners — by any other name.

Because only Casey Seiler can do such a Tale of Actual Legislation justice, from his report earlier in the year:

Assemblywoman Ellen Jaffee and Sen. Tony Avella are the most recent lawmakers to address the problem of the misbranding of escolar — aka walu or the snake mackerel — a fish that while reputed to be rich and delicious can have a rather, well, unpleasant impact on a certain subset of diners.

The justification memo on their bill points to multiple investigations — including a 2011 Boston Globe report that while comprehensive and worthwhile will almost certainly never be made into an Oscar-winning movie — that “revealed significant levels of fraud and species misidentification” on menus.
